We specialize in offering recycled mi l scale, which refers to the reclaimed or repurposed mil scale derived from hot roled steel surfaces. Instead of being discarded as waste, this recycled mi l scale undergoes meticulous processing to extract valuable components or transform it into usable materials. This versatile resource finds application across various industrial sectors, including iron and steel production, where it serves as a source of iron oxides in blast furnaces or electric arc furnaces. Moreover, it contributes to cement production as an essential component in cement clinker, enhancing the chemical composition of the final product.Additionaly, recycled mil scale finds utility in diverse industrial applications, such as the production of ferrous sulfate for agricultural and water treatment purposes, or as a constituent in specialty products and construction materials. We are glad to propose 500 MT of stain less steel mill scale. Mill scale is formed on the outer surfaces during by the hot rolling lamination of stainless-steel products. At a visual inspection the material is a hard brittle sand and is mainly composed of iron oxides, mostly ferric, and is bluish black in colour, but it also contains considerable alloying elements such as chromium and nickel. The recovery ratio after melting in furnace for the most valuable alloy elements is: - Ni: 3.5 - 4.5% - Cr: 6-8% From the chemical and physical analysis performed on the scrap, and according to the European environmental rules, the material has been classified as a special non dangerous waste, listed in green list. In particular the mill scale can be classified as follows: Waste code: 10 02 10 The material is stored on cemented flooring, and it can be loaded loose in tipper trucks or containers. Chemical analysis of the material is available on request.
Gremlog Trading DMCC stands at the forefront of technological innovation with our advanced cryolite production, a pivotal component in the aluminium smelting process. Cryolite acts as a solvent for Bauxite, playing a critical role in the extraction of aluminium through the Hal-H�©roult electrolytic process. Our state-of-the-art production facilities employ rigorous quality control measures to ensure the highest standards of purity and particle size distribution in our cryolite offerings. As an integral part of aluminium production, cryolite functions as a conductive medium, facilitating the dissolution of alumina and enabling the extraction of aluminium metal. Our cryolite is engineered to possess optimal chemical and physical properties, enhancing its efficiency in the electrolysis process. Its precisely controlled particle sizes, available in various dimensions including 0-5 mm, 5-20 mm, 20-40 mm, 0-40 mm, and 5-40 mm, cater to the diverse needs of industries engaged in aluminium smelting.
